Wehrmacht Panzer Assault Badge in Bronze (Panzerkampfabzeichen)
This is an original Panzer Assault Badge, awarded to tank crew members of the German Army (Heer) who participated in armored assaults during World War II. Introduced on December 20, 1939, the badge recognized the service of panzer troops involved in at least three combat engagements on separate days.
This example is the bronze grade, typically awarded to members of mechanized infantry or support units operating alongside armored divisions. The design features a detailed image of a Panzer IV tank set within an oak leaf wreath, topped with a Wehrmacht eagle and swastika emblem.
Crafted from a zinc alloy with bronze wash, this badge shows signs of age and wear consistent with use, yet retains good detail in both the tank and wreath. The reverse features a standard pin and catch system (not pictured), typical of wartime manufacturing.
